Camden Academy Charter High School is a four-year public charter high school that serves students in ninth through twelfth grades from Camden, in Camden County, New Jersey, United States. The school is part of Camden's Promise Charter School and operates under the terms of a charter granted by the New Jersey Department of Education.[3]
As of the 2016-17 school year, Camden's Promise Charter School had a total enrollment of 1,907 students and 181.4 classroom teachers (on an FTE basis), for a student–teacher ratio of 10.5:1. There were 1,518 students (79.6% of enrollment) eligible for free lunch and 202 (10.6% of students) eligible for reduced-cost lunch.[1]
Awards, recognition and honors
The school was the 249th-ranked public high school in New Jersey out of 339 schools statewide in New Jersey Monthly magazine's September 2014 cover story on the state's "Top Public High Schools".[4]
Athletics
The Camden Academy Charter High School Cougars compete independently of any league or conference and operates under the auspices of the New Jersey State Interscholastic Athletic Association.[2][5] With 505 students in grades 10-12, the school was classified by the NJSIAA for the 2019-20 school year as Group II for most athletic competition purposes, which included schools with an enrollment of 486 to 758 students in that grade range.[6] Interscholastic sports offered by the school include baseball, basketball (men and women), softball and volleyball (men and women).[2]
